NO. 15 EMISSION COMPLIANCE [MZI-3.5]
DESCRIPTION AND POSSIBLE CAUSES
15
EMISSION COMPLIANCE
DESCRIPTION
Fails emissions test.

Vacuum lines leakage or blockage
Cooling system malfunction
Spark plug malfunction
Leakage from intake manifold
Erratic or no signal from CMP sensor
Inadequate fuel pressure
PCV valve malfunction or incorrect valve installation
Exhaust system clogging
Fuel tank ventilation system malfunction
Fuel-filler cap malfunction
Charcoal canister damage
Air cleaner element clogging or restriction
Throttle body malfunction
Erratic signal to ignition coil
Improper air/fuel mixture ratio control operation
Bend or open circuit HO2S wiring harness
Catalyst converter malfunction
Engine internal parts malfunction
Excessive carbon is built up in combustion chamber
